Two-thirds of UK homes still have an EPC rating of D or below. That is roughly 19 million properties leaking heat and money. The standard route to fixing them, a retrofit assessment, costs £200 to £600 per home and requires a surveyor to visit, measure, and photograph every room. It is slow, expensive, and puts off precisely the households who need help most.
New work from the Stockholm Environment Institute, published this month, suggests a faster way. Researchers used publicly available data, Energy Performance Certificate records, Ordnance Survey maps, and aerial photographs, combined with a computer vision model trained to spot insulation defects. They tested it on 700 social housing blocks in London. The model identified which buildings had cavity-wall insulation, which had solid walls, and which had missing or damaged insulation. Accuracy was over 85% for most categories.
Who qualifies, and who doesn’t
The study focused on social housing, but the method works for any home visible from above. Semi-detached houses, bungalows, and terraced rows all appear in aerial imagery. For flats in high-rise blocks, the model can assess the roof and top-floor walls. The catch is that it cannot see inside. Internal insulation, loft hatches, and underfloor upgrades are invisible from the air. So the technique is best used as a triage tool: flag the homes that almost certainly need work, then send surveyors only to the ambiguous cases.
Ofgem and the Department for Energy Security and Net Zero have not yet adopted this approach. But the Energy Saving Trust told the Axiom team that “any tool that reduces assessment costs is welcome, provided it meets the accuracy standards for PAS 2035”, the government’s retrofit quality framework. The study’s authors estimate that scaling this method across England could cut the national survey bill by £140m a year.
What it costs a typical 3-bed semi
For a homeowner in a 1930s semi in Manchester, a full retrofit assessment today runs about £350. If that could be replaced by a £50 automated desktop analysis, or bundled free with a local authority scheme, the saving is £300. That is the difference between proceeding with a heat pump quote and abandoning it. The average air-source heat pump installation now costs £7,000 to £13,000 after the Boiler Upgrade Scheme grant. Reducing the upfront friction by even a few hundred pounds matters when household budgets are stretched.
The study also found that the computer vision model could detect solar-panel-ready roofs: orientation, pitch, and shading from nearby trees. That data is already available from satellite imagery, but it is not yet linked to EPC databases in any systematic way. A single platform that shows you your roof’s potential, your wall type, and your likely grant eligibility, all generated from public data, would be a genuinely useful tool.
The catch: data gaps and privacy
What this misses is the human element. Aerial images cannot tell you whether the loft has been boarded, whether the cavity walls have partial fill, or whether the tenant has mould. The researchers acknowledge that their method works best on uniform housing stock, estates built in a single phase with consistent materials. For Victorian terraces and mixed-era conversions, accuracy drops. And while the data is public, some residents may object to their home being scanned without consent. The Information Commissioner’s Office has not yet ruled on whether this use of aerial imagery falls under the UK GDPR exemptions for public-interest research.
But the direction of travel is clear. The government’s own Net Zero Strategy calls for 19 million homes to be retrofitted by 2050. At the current rate of 60,000 upgrades per year, that target is unachievable without a step change in assessment speed. Computer vision will not replace the surveyor. It could, however, replace the clipboard.
